What is a Built-in Electric Oven?
A built-in electric oven is developed to be installed within cabinets or walls, effortlessly blending into the kitchen's architecture. Unlike standalone ovens, these models conserve floor space and can be situated at eye level, facilitating easy access and monitoring while cooking.

Built-in electric ovens need sufficient electrical circuitry and ventilation alternatives. It's suggested to seek advice from specialists throughout the setup stage to fulfill electrical codes and make sure safety.

Are built-in electric ovens more effective than standard ovens?
Yes, built-in electric ovens often have better insulation and functions like convection cooking that can cook food faster and evenly, saving energy.
2. Can I set up a built-in electric oven myself?
While some handy individuals may pick to try a DIY setup, it is advised to hire an expert to guarantee safe and certified installation.
3. Just how much power does a built-in electric oven use?
Normally, built-in electric ovens consume between 2,400 to 5,000 watts, depending on the model and features. Always refer to the maker's requirements for accurate figures.
4. Do built-in electric ovens require special kitchen cabinetry?
Yes, built-in electric ovens need custom-made kitchen cabinetry or wall enclaves that support their weight and permit appropriate ventilation. Guarantee that the kitchen cabinetry adheres to installation guidelines laid out by the manufacturer.
